Wagering on Web3: Decoding Decentralized Sportsbooks and Their Edge
The burgeoning world of Web3 is revolutionizing various industries, and sports betting is no exception. Decentralized sportsbooks, built on blockchain technology, offer a compelling alternative to traditional platforms. Unlike their centralized counterparts, these Web3 iterations operate without a single point of control, fostering unprecedented transparency and security. Every wager, every payout, and every transaction is recorded on an immutable ledger, verifiable by anyone. This eliminates the risk of hidden fees, biased odds, or outright fraud that can plague conventional betting sites. Furthermore, the inherent censorship resistance of blockchain ensures that these platforms remain accessible to users globally, free from arbitrary restrictions or shutdowns. This fundamental shift from opaque, centralized systems to open, transparent ones is a core advantage.
Beyond transparency, decentralized sportsbooks leverage Web3's innovative features to deliver a truly enhanced betting experience. They often incorporate smart contracts for automated payouts, ensuring winners receive their funds instantly and without intermediaries. This not only speeds up the process but also eliminates the need for trust in a third party. Many platforms also integrate with cryptocurrencies, offering
- lower transaction fees
- faster settlement times
- greater privacy

Crypto Casino Play: Navigating Blockchain-Based Gambling & Key Differences
The rise of crypto casinos marks a significant evolution in the online gambling landscape, leveraging the foundational principles of blockchain technology to offer a radically different experience. Unlike traditional online casinos, which rely on centralized servers and often opaque systems, crypto casinos operate on decentralized networks, providing an unprecedented level of transparency and verifiable fairness. This shift is primarily driven by the use of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, Ethereum, and others for deposits, withdrawals, and even gameplay. The underlying blockchain ensures that every transaction is immutably recorded and publicly auditable, fostering greater trust among players. This transparency extends to game outcomes, with many crypto casinos utilizing provably fair algorithms, allowing players to independently verify the randomness and integrity of each game round.
Key differences between traditional and blockchain-based gambling extend beyond just payment methods. One significant advantage of crypto casinos is the enhanced privacy they offer. Players can often gamble pseudonymously, without the extensive KYC (Know Your Customer) procedures typically required by traditional platforms. Furthermore, transaction speeds are often significantly faster, especially for withdrawals, as there are no intermediary banks or financial institutions to process payments. However, it's crucial for players to understand the unique characteristics of this emerging sector. Considerations include:
- Cryptocurrency Volatility: The value of your winnings can fluctuate significantly.
- Wallet Security: Players are responsible for securing their own crypto wallets.
- Regulatory Landscape: The legal framework for crypto gambling is still evolving in many jurisdictions.
